mac.. <br /> May 18, 1988 AGS Job No. 038032-1 <br /> UNorAL Station No. 6981, Stockton, California <br /> Three 12,000-gallon underground storage tanks are located at the <br /> site. Approximate locations of the storage tanks and other . <br /> ,tuctires are depicted on the Generalized Site Plan, Plate P-2. <br /> Previous Mork <br /> f� <br /> _ on May 13, 1: 88, Applied Geosystems collected 9 soil samples from <br /> 4-foot deep test- pits located on each side of the two dispenser <br /> islands and one located perpendicular to the dispenser islands at <br /> the southern end. Applied Geosystems collected one sample from <br /> 8-feet bei.ow grade in a test pit located on the east s33e of the <br /> o <br /> western dispenser island, Three soil samples were also collected <br /> and composited from the stockpiled soil on site. These samples <br /> were collected in response to detected contamination during <br /> installation of a blending valve at the service station. The <br /> blending valve is designed to mix different types of gasoline in <br /> a 60% to 40% ratio. According to the contractor small holes were <br /> noted in the farmer underground piping associated with the <br /> dispenser lines during installation of the blending valve. <br /> Underground product lines at the station have since been removed <br /> and are being replaced wi-Fh completely new plumbing. <br /> Results of soil samples analyses indicated total petroleum <br /> hydrocarbon levels ranging from not detectable to 382 parts per <br /> 2 <br /> APPI ed aeo rystelns <br />
